DIGITAL SKILLS FOR EVERYDAY LIFE ¡Se habla Español! Digital Literacy for Everyday Life is a supportive, hands-on class designed to help adults build confidence and practical skills with technology. This course is open to all skill levels, from complete beginners to those looking to expand their digital knowledge. Instruction will be flexible and personalized, combining small group lessons with one-on-one support to meet each learner’s individual needs. Participants will learn essential skills such as using a computer mouse and keyboard, adjusting phone settings, sending emails, accessing and organizing photos, and navigating the internet. More advanced learners will have opportunities to explore topics such as online job applications, digital communication, content creation (including YouTube), and the effective use of modern tools such as AI. This class emphasizes real-life application, helping participants gain independence and confidence in using technology for everyday tasks such as communication, employment, and personal interests. Whether a participant is just getting started or looking to grow their skills, this class provides a welcoming and supportive environment for all learners. Camp Creepers and Leapers- Herpetology Get ready to hop, slither, and explore! Camp Creepers & Leapers is a hands-on herpetology adventure where young scientists dive into the amazing world of reptiles and amphibians. Designed for curious minds ages 9–13, this camp blends outdoor exploration, creative projects, and real science skills in a fun, supportive environment. Over four action-packed days, campers will investigate frogs, lizards, snakes, turtles and more, with live animals visiting the classroom each day. Along the way, they’ll keep a field journal, learn how scientists observe wildlife safely, and build confidence in exploring the natural world. Students will develop a deeper appreciation for Wyoming’s native herps and for reptiles and amphibians all around the world. WWCC room 1408 For age-9-13 Instructor: Jerrica Brasington
